Traveling from Falta to Asansol involves navigating towards Kolkata and then heading northwest along the Grand Trunk Road (NH 19). The total distance is roughly 230 km. You can take a taxi to Howrah Station and board one of the many frequent trains like the Black Diamond Express. The road route is ideal for those preferring flexibility, though train travel is significantly faster and more comfortable.

Total Distance: 230 km by road, 205 km straight-line.
Fastest Way
Train is the fastest, taking about 3.5 hours including the transit to Howrah.
Cheapest Way
Train from Howrah to Asansol is the cheapest, costing around 250 INR in sleeper class.

Travel Tips
  • Station Choice
    Asansol Junction is the main hub; ensure your train stops there.
  • Traffic
    The stretch between Bardhaman and Asansol can be congested during peak hours.
  • Local Food
    Try the local sweets in Asansol, especially the 'Mihidana' and 'Sitabhog' if available.
  • Booking
    Use the UTS app for unreserved train tickets to save time at the station.
  • Navigation
    Download offline maps as signal strength can fluctuate in rural pockets.
